What You Need to Have a Successful Career

What You Need to Have a Successful Career

Over your lifetime, one of the places where you will spend the majority of your time is your workplace, and this means that you need to be happy and content within the career option that you choose. However, career success does not come easily to everyone, and if you are struggling to climb up the ladder, here is everything that you need to open doors within your industry:

 

  • Soft Skills

 

Although you might believe that qualifications are the most important element of your resume, this is not always the case, and soft skills can help to broaden the opportunities that are available to you. These soft skills are especially important as you start to climb the ranks, with many different positions, even within the same industry, requiring different soft skills. The most common soft skills that employers look for include good oral and written communication, great organization and time-keeping, and excellent team-work and collaboration skills.   • Professional Connections 

 

Once you have obtained the basics that you need to have a successful career, you then need to start to cultivate your professional connections within your field. Professional connections are now vital for those that are looking for long and exciting careers. This is because these connections can allow you to hear about job opportunities in your sector, including leadership opportunities, and to get advice about the best path to take. So, to develop these contacts, you should consider attending networking events that are specifically tailored toward your industry and creating an account on business social media websites, such as LinkedIn. 

 

  • Industry Experience 

 

Most employers, though, are looking for professionals who have a high level of experience in their sector as this can prevent them from having to train individuals and will ensure that they can relax in the knowledge that their business is in good hands. However, this need for experience can act as a barrier to many career-minded individuals who are looking to progress or to achieve a promotion, especially if they have not worked within a certain job position before. Therefore, to get industry experience, you should consider taking on more projects alongside your work, develop your own projects and ideas, or consider going on work experience or a job exchange. If you are mid-career and want to find more experience opportunities in order to grow your leadership potential, you should ask for more responsibility at work, ask to lead projects, and even consider running a group outside of work, such as a youth group. 

 

  • A Smart Resume and Portfolio 

 

However, whether you are looking to start out on your career path or to become a leader within your industry, the one document that will enable you to get through the door is your resume. Your resume must be able to represent you to employers and to show you in your best light, as you will only be able to obtain interviews on the strength of this. If you are struggling to write a great resume, you should consider using online templates or speaking to a professional careers advisor. When you are looking for leadership positions or to progress your career, you should also create a portfolio of your previous work that can showcase your experience and the type of work that you are willing to offer the companies that you are applying to work for. Not only this, but you should consider creating a website where you can present your personal brand and build an impressive archive that will allow you to stand out to employers. 

 

  • Confidence 

 

The one characteristic that you need to succeed, though, is confidence. When you believe in your talents, everyone else will, too, regardless of your experience or your qualifications. Not only this but as you climb up the ladder, employers will be looking for strong leaders who can make decisions and who are comfortable in their own abilities. Then, to grow confidence in your abilities, you should create positive self-talk, focus on your achievements, and work on a plan to help you to overcome the challenges and barriers that you are facing. 

 

  • Career Goals

 

Career goals are essential to prevent your career from becoming stale and to stop you from getting stuck in the same job role for many years to come. Career goals give you something to aim for and can allow you to celebrate and reward yourself for passing certain milestones. As well as having career goals, you should create an overall vision of where you want to be in five and ten years, and this will allow you to get some perspective and ensure that you are always working toward your career goals and going in the right direction. Some of the best career goals that you can set for 2021 include gaining new skills, taking relevant courses, improving your work output, getting a promotion, and finding a job that fulfills you.
